James Macmillan 1959 is a famous composer and conductor in England.Now,"there are three themes that are widely recognized in academia to influence and identify the baseline of Mc Millan works,namely Catholic spirit,Scottish identity and social consciousness." The Catholic spirit is originated from Mc Millan's own Catholic belief,Scottish identity comes from the persistence of folk music.Social consciousness is more about Macmillan trying to express a social problem with music."Social consciousness" is an abstract concept attribute,which is more existing in the composer's creative view,value view and understanding view,which is difficult to present in the specific composition technique.Therefore,this paper takes the "Catholic spirit" and "Scottish identity" as the baseline of this study to identify the three characteristics of Macmillan music works,and tries to explain the performance of "Catholic spirit" and "Scottish identity" in the composition technique level.Through analyzing and summarizing the common pitch relationship in Macmillan music works,studying the structure and development of music theme,studying the music language and style characteristics of macmilan,discussing the source,construction logic,structure relationship and the creation ideas behind the music theme in his works.In addition,the innovation of the instrument writing in Mc Millan is analyzed.The first chapter mainly describes the composer's life,music outlook and music style;The second chapter mainly analyzes the organizational structure of the high sound in the works;Chapter three studies the construction characteristics of music theme in the works;Chapter four starts with music materials,and studies the writing style of the accessories of Mc Millan.
